Analysis: The Impact of Nick Chubb’s Injury on the Cleveland Browns
The Devastating Blow to the Browns
The Cleveland Browns suffered a major setback in their Monday Night Football matchup against the Pittsburgh Steelers in Week 2. Running back Nick Chubb, a vital part of the Browns’ offense, was carted off the field with a knee injury. The severity of the injury is yet to be determined, but the immediate impact was evident as Chubb was ruled out for the remainder of the game.
The Importance of Nick Chubb
Nick Chubb has been a key contributor for the Browns since he was drafted in 2018. Known for his explosive running style and exceptional vision, Chubb has been a consistent playmaker and a reliable option for the Browns’ offense. His ability to break tackles and gain yards after contact has made him one of the most effective running backs in the league.
Chubb’s injury not only affects the Browns’ rushing attack but also puts additional pressure on quarterback Deshaun Watson to carry the offense. Without Chubb’s presence in the backfield, defenses can focus more on stopping the passing game, making it harder for the Browns to sustain drives and find success on offense.
The Outcomes of the Game
Despite Chubb’s injury, the Browns managed to stay competitive against the Steelers, scoring touchdowns and keeping the game close. However, their efforts fell short, and they ultimately lost the game 26-22. This loss highlights the challenges the Browns will face without Chubb’s consistent production on the field.
